Summary of the main styles and ideas checked out in the book
In "Is Death The Final Destination?: A Peek of The Afterlife" by John White, the author looks into extensive concerns about what awaits us beyond this life. White skillfully checks out different themes and ideas surrounding the afterlife, providing readers a thought-provoking journey through various viewpoints on death and what may lie ahead.
The book explores subjects such as near-death experiences, reincarnation, spiritual realms, and the nature of consciousness beyond physical presence. White presents a varied series of beliefs and theories from different cultures and spiritual traditions, inviting readers to consider the mysteries of life after death.

Suggestion for readers who have an interest in checking out the topic further
For readers fascinated by the mysteries of the afterlife, "Is Death The Final Destination?: A Glimpse of The Afterlife" by John White is a captivating read that delves into extensive questions. To further explore this thought-provoking topic, consider diving into works like "Life After Life" learn more by Raymond Moody and "The Tibetan Book of Living and Dying" by Sogyal Rinpoche.
These books offer varied viewpoints on what lies beyond our earthly existence, improving your understanding of the afterlife. Furthermore, exploring Near-Death Experience (NDE) accounts shared in books such as "Proof of Heaven" by Eben Alexander can supply interesting insights into the potential extension of consciousness post-death.
